Walsall manager Jon Whitney has spoken to the local press ahead of this weekend's League One clash with Bradford City, and has revealed that he and his team will be working hard on their defensive solidity, especially from set-pieces, as they look to avoid a repeat of their disappointing defeat to Southend United.

Speaking via the Express & Star, Jon said; "From Monday I want to really starting drilling the players to improve us for the rest of this season and for next year as well. I want to try and nip a few things in the bud. It’s no secret we are going to concentrate on set-pieces.

"I want to make sure we are more hungry to keep the ball out the net. I want us to start enjoying set-piece defending like I did when I played. It’s been difficult because haven’t had all the group together and it’s important we don’t get too down because in general play we are okay.

"But it’s those dead ball situations we have to do better with. At the end of the day it’s just a willingness to keep the ball out."
